1. Definition Eriodictyon Crassifolium Leaf Extract:

Eriodictyon Crassifolium Leaf Extract is a botanical extract derived from the leaves of the Eriodictyon crassifolium plant, also known as the thick-leaved yerba santa. It is known for its antioxidant, anti-inflammatory, and soothing properties, making it a popular ingredient in skincare products.

2. Use:

Eriodictyon Crassifolium Leaf Extract is commonly used in cosmetics for its skin-protecting and rejuvenating benefits. It helps to combat free radicals, reduce inflammation, and promote overall skin health. This extract is often found in anti-aging creams, serums, and moisturizers to help improve the appearance of fine lines, wrinkles, and other signs of aging.
